08-08-2011, 10:15 PM
Picked up moulds today.
Cast with them. Dimensions right on.
Wight with my WW material 211.6Gr.
http://i69.photobucket.com/albums/i80/swedenelson/432200grRN44-40004.jpg
Mould block temp 360F to 365F
Pot temp 680F to 690F

Finish QC and start to mail them out in the next day or two.

Savvy Jack
08-13-2011, 08:19 PM
what load are you using Savvy Jack?

Uberti Cattleman 5.5" Barrel

RP Brass
WLPs
38gr Swiss FF
Tapped settled, then
Compression die with .20 compression
Roll crimp

50' bench rest (but not perfect)
1.5" groups with 6 shots

951fps@435ft/lbs of energy

I think with the proper bench rest and shooter, it's a tack driver. I think for the long distance shots, others will use 35gr of Swiss FF

I loaded up 6 more with CCI 300 primers...don't waist your time. Don't have any CCI Magnum primers.

I really like them!
